WebWhat’s also typical among Latinos is a diabetes diagnosis. Latinos are the largest minority group in the United States, and their prevalence of diabetes is twice that of non-Hispanic whites. Latinos tend to have higher hemoglobin A1c levels, greater rates of obesity, diabetes complications, and associated mortality. Over their lifetime, US adults overall have a 40% chance of developing type 2 diabetes. But if you’re a Hispanic or Latino adult, your chance is more than 50%, and you’re likely to develop it at a younger age. WebThis systematic review examined the effectiveness of diabetes prevention programs for Hispanics in lowering risk for Type 2 diabetes, as evidenced by a reduction in weight or … WebDesigned specifically for the Hispanic/Latino community, Por Tu Familia or “For your Family” is a fun, activity-based, educational program about the prevention and management of diabetes. The American Diabetes Association’s Por Tu Familia program is a series of nine easy-to-understand workshops available in both English and Spanish.
